Severe Thunderstorm Warning issued June 14 at 6:39PM EDT until June 14 at 7:15PM EDT by NWS Charleston WV
The National Weather Service in Charleston West Virginia has issued a * Severe Thunderstorm Warning for...
Northeastern Doddridge County in northern West Virginia...
West central Taylor County in northern West Virginia...
East central Tyler County in northern West Virginia...
Harrison County in northern West Virginia...

* Until 715 PM EDT.

* At 639 PM EDT, a severe thunderstorm was located near Jacksonburg, or 13 miles west of Mannington, moving southeast at 40 mph.
HAZARD...60 mph wind gusts and quarter size hail.
SOURCE...Radar indicated.
IMPACT...Hail damage to vehicles is expected. Expect wind damage to roofs, siding, and trees.

* Locations impacted include...
Clarksburg, Bridgeport, Shinnston, Stonewood, Nutter Fort, Lumberport, Anmoore, Enterprise, Wolf Summit, Meadland, Wallace, McGee, Meadowbrook and Despard.
This includes the following highways...
Interstate 79 between mile markers 112 and 128.
Route 50 in West Virginia between mile markers 72 and 82.
